    Table Of Content
    CHAPTERS Introduction to Computing 1 1: The PIC Microcontrollers: History and Features 23 2: PIC Architecture & Assembly Language Programming 39 3: Branch, Call, and Time Delay Loop 97 4: PIC I/O Port Programming 129 5: Arithmetic, Logic Instructions, and Programs 155 6: Bank Switching, Table Processing, Macros, and Modules 193 7: PIC Programming in C 251 8: PIC18F Hardware Connection and ROM Loaders 299 9: PIC18 Timer Programming in Assembly and C 335 10: PIC18 Serial Port Programming in Assembly and C 387 11: Interrupt Programming in Assembly and C 423 12: LCD and Keyboard Interfacing 473 13: ADC, DAC, and Sensor Interfacing 499 14: Using Flash and EEPROM Memories for Data Storage 529 15: CCP and ECCP Programming 569 16: SPI Protocol and DS1306 RTC Interfacing 603 17: Motor Control: Relay, PWM, DC, and Stepper Motors 635 APPENDICES A: PIC18 Instructions: Format and Description 673 B: Basics of Wire Wrapping 721 C: IC Technology and System Design Issues 725 D: Flowcharts and Pseudocode 745 E: PIC18 Primer for x86 and 8051 Programmers 750 F: ASCII Codes 752 G: Assemblers, Development Resources, and Suppliers 754 H: Data Sheets 756
    Synopsis
    For courses in Embedded System Design, Microcontroller's Software & Hardware, Microprocessor Interfacing, Microprocessor Assembly Language Programming, Peripheral Interfacing, Senior Project Design, Embedded System Programming with C. PIC Microcontroller and Embedded Systems offers a systematic approach to PIC programming and interfacing using Assembly and C languages . Offering numerous examples and a step-by-step approach, it covers both the Assembly and C programming languages and devotes separate chapters to interfacing with peripherals such as Timers, LCD, Serial Ports, Interrupts, Motors and more. A unique chapter on hardware design of the PIC system and the PIC trainer round out coverage, while text appendices and online support make it easy to use in the lab and classroom., Offers a systematic approach to PIC programming and interfacing using Assembly and C languages.
